Learning Devise for Rails. (2013)
- Record Type:
- Book
- Title:
- Learning Devise for Rails. (2013)
- Main Title:
- Learning Devise for Rails
- Further Information:
- Note: Hafiz, Nia Mutiara, Giovanni Sakti.
- Other Names:
- Hafiz
Mutiara, Nia
Sakti, Giovanni - Contents:
- Cover; Copyright; Credits; About the Authors; About the Reviewers; www.PacktPub.com; Table of Contents; Preface; Chapter 1: Devise -- Authentication Solution for Ruby on Rails; Devise modules; Installation; Run your first application with Devise; Summary; Chapter 2: Authenticating Your Application with Devise; Signing in using authentication other than e-mails; Updating the user account; Signing up the user with confirmation; Resetting your password; Canceling your account; Customizing Devise actions and routes; Customizing your Devise layout; Integrating Devise with Mongoid; Summary. Chapter 3: PrivilegesCollabBlogs -- a web application for collaborative writing; Advanced CanCan usages; Defining rules using SQL; Simplifying authorization checks on controllers; Ensuring abilities' correctness; Testing; Debugging; Summary; Chapter 4: Remote Authentication with Devise and OmniAuth; Remote authentication; OmniAuth; Implementing remote authentication in our application; Preparing your application; Remote authentication using Twitter; Registering our application at the Twitter developer site; Configuring OmniAuth for authentication using Twitter. Remote authentication using FacebookRegistering our application at the Facebook developer site; Configuring OmniAuth for authentication using Facebook; Summary; Chapter 5: Testing Devise; The sign-up test; The user update test; The user deletion test; The sign-in test; The Remote authentication test; Summary; Index.
- Publisher Details:
- Birmingham : Packt Publishing
- Publication Date:
- 2013
- Extent:
- 1 online resource (104 pages), illustrations
- Subjects:
- 005.367
COMPUTERS -- Security -- Online Safety & Privacy
Application software -- Development
Object-oriented programming (Computer science)
COMPUTERS -- Security -- Networking
Electronic books
Electronic books - Languages:
- English
- ISBNs:
- 9781782167051
1782167056
9781782167044
1782167048 - Notes:
- Note: Online resource; title from PDF title page (ebrary, viewed November 23, 2013).
- Access Rights:
- Legal Deposit; Only available on premises controlled by the deposit library and to one user at any one time; The Legal Deposit Libraries (Non-Print Works) Regulations (UK).
- Access Usage:
- Restricted: Printing from this resource is governed by The Legal Deposit Libraries (Non-Print Works) Regulations (UK) and UK copyright law currently in force.
- View Content:
- Available online (eLD content is only available in our Reading Rooms) ↗
- Physical Locations:
- British Library HMNTS - ELD.DS.86768
- Ingest File:
- 01_120.xml